How Far Apart Should Fence Posts Be? A Clear Guide for Homeowners
With wood fences, spacing usually lands between 6 and 8 feet. That’s the general rule for keeping wood posts stable and upright while minimizing sag between fence panels.
Do I Need a Permit to Build a Fence? A Homeowner’s Guide for Seattle and Portland
In Seattle, you can install a fence without a building permit if: it is 6 feet tall or shorter, it is located in a backyard or side yard, and it is not attached to or built on top of a retaining wall.
